Summary
Overview
Work history
Education
Skills
Websites
Timeline
Hi, I’m

Shihab Kandil

Flutter developer
Barnsley,South Yorkshire
Shihab Kandil

Summary

Experienced Software Developer with expertise in developing robust web and mobile applications using the Flutter framework. Proficient in integrating payment gateways, conducting unit testing, and implementing CI/CD workflows with GitHub Actions. Adept at working with REST APIs and GraphQL, with strong knowledge of state management solutions like Provider and BLoC. Passionate about delivering high-quality solutions that drive user satisfaction and business growth.

Overview

3
years of professional experience
4
years of post-secondary education

Work history

Nugttah
Remote

Flutter Developer
04.2022 - 10.2024

Job overview

  • Led creation of an analytics application, "Wiser", for business owners, featuring interactive charts and detailed business insights. Navigate business with data-driven clarity—from market dynamics to customer loyalty.
  • Worked on 'Nugttah Manager' cashier application and played a key role in updating dependencies, rebuilding the app with a new UI design, and adding Bluetooth and Sunmi printing functionalities.
    Maintained and improved the existing codebase to ensure smooth performance and enhanced user experience.
  • Solved over 40 issues related to the ordering process, enhancing system reliability, and user satisfaction.
  • Contributed to a fork of fl_chart package, adding more customised UI elements to use in the Wiser application, rendering the interactive charts in our own design.

SB Technology
Cairo, Egypt

Software engineer
08.2023 - 02.2024

Job overview

  • Addressed bug fixes and resolved issues identified by the testing team for our company's HR Flutter application, ensuring seamless functionality and user satisfaction.
  • Created immersive 3D VR environments for interior design projects using Unity, tailored for Meta Quest VR headsets, offering clients interactive experiences.

EBIN
Remote

Flutter Developer
04.2022 - 07.2022

Job overview

  • Developed the "E-Bin" mobile app for convenient waste collection requests via smartphones, optimising and streamlining the process.
  • Built an admin application with features such as importing user data from Excel sheets into app forms, enhancing efficiency and accuracy in data entry processes.

PlayBox
Remote

Flutter Developer
03.2022 - 04.2022

Job overview

  • Identified and resolved performance issues in their application, significantly improving app speed and responsiveness.
  • Developed a user-friendly solution to address the white frames rendering problem experienced by users when using Google Maps in dark customized theme.
  • Hosted a Google Cloud Function to handle computationally intensive tasks and calculations, resulting in faster processing and improved scalability.

Education

Misr International University

Computer Science
08.2019 - 06.2023

University overview

GPA: 3.28

Skills

  • Firebase services
  • Google Cloud Functions
  • Payment gateways integration
  • Unit Testing, Widget Testing, Integration Testing
  • CI/CD workflows using GitHub Actions
  • Responsive & Adaptive design translation to code
  • REST API integration
  • Provider, BLoC state managements
  • GraphQL integration
  • Familarity with native iOS (SwiftUI) & Android (Kotlin)
  • Git version control (AzureDevOps / Github / Gitlab )

Timeline

Software engineer

SB Technology
08.2023 - 02.2024

Flutter Developer

Nugttah
04.2022 - 10.2024

Flutter Developer

EBIN
04.2022 - 07.2022

Flutter Developer

PlayBox
03.2022 - 04.2022

Misr International University

Computer Science
08.2019 - 06.2023
Shihab KandilFlutter developer